Paderborn's Laurin Curda (l.) and Mika Baur celebrate promotion to the Bundesliga

As of: May 26, 2026 • 11:00 a.m

SC Paderborn has achieved promotion to the Bundesliga: players and coaches want to celebrate for several days.

Winning goal scorer Laurin Curda announced a sleepless night in the midst of the joy-drunk supporters on the pitch before the promotion heroes poured beer on their coach Ralf Kettemann.

“I still can’t believe it,” said Curda: “It’s crazy what’s going on here. You only know it from TV and suddenly you’re right in the middle of it. As a little boy, it’s a dream and it’s now coming true.” He “probably won’t sleep at all” until the official party at the town hall on Tuesday at 5 p.m.

The team will then head to Mallorca, where the celebrations will last for several days.

Enjoy the festive atmosphere

After the 2:1 (1:1, 1:1) after extra time in the relegation second leg against VfL Wolfsburg, thousands of supporters stormed the pitch in an orderly manner and turned the pitch into a party zone. “It’s one of the best things. It’s just pure joy, a nice feeling,” said equalizer Bilbija.

It was “simply unbelievable” and “unique,” ​​enthused goalkeeper Dennis Seimen on Sat.1. The team “deserved” the third promotion in the club’s history and was “enjoying the celebratory atmosphere”.

Coach Kettemann needs some rest first

Meanwhile, his coach needed some rest and disappeared into the dressing room for a few minutes shortly after the final whistle. When we returned to the pitch, the obligatory beer shower followed.

“It’s hard to describe. I needed some rest for a moment. It was very intense and tough,” said Kettemann on Sky: “It was surreal. I had to give myself a moment to breathe deeply.”

Historic evening in Paderborn

Now it’s time to celebrate before planning for the Bundesliga begins. “The club has already been promoted twice, but it hasn’t stayed there yet,” emphasized the coach: “We have to make smart decisions.”

The key to promotion was that the SCP was “one team,” explained club veteran Sven Michel: “We are a huge team, everyone stands up for everyone else.” It will only be understood in many years what we have achieved.
